Cheesecake Factory Godiva Chocolate Cheesecake

Ingredients
  

For the crust:

1 ½ cups chocolate cookie crumbs (like Oreo cookies)

½ cup unsalted butter, melted

3 tablespoons granulated sugar

For the cheesecake filling:

4 (8 oz) packages cream cheese, softened

1 cup granulated sugar

4 large eggs

1 cup sour cream

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

1 cup Godiva chocolate liqueur

8 oz semi-sweet chocolate, melted and cooled

For the chocolate ganache topping:

1 cup heavy cream

8 oz semi-sweet chocolate, chopped

1 tablespoon Godiva chocolate liqueur (optional)

For garnish:

Chocolate shavings or curls

Whipped cream

Instructions
 

Prepare the crust:

    - Preheat the oven to 325°F (160°C).

      - In a medium bowl, combine the chocolate cookie crumbs, melted butter, and granulated sugar. Mix until the crumbs are evenly coated.

        - Press the m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an. Bake for 10 minutes, then let it cool while you prepare the filling.

          Make the cheesecake filling:

            - In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with an electric mixer until smooth and creamy, about 2-3 minutes.

              - Gradually add in the granulated sugar, beating until well combined.

                - Add in the eggs, one at a time, mixing on low speed to avoid incorporating too much air. Scrape down the sides of the bowl as needed.

                  - Mix in the sour cream, vanilla extract, and Godiva chocolate liqueur until smooth.

                    - Finally, fold in the melted and cooled semi-sweet chocolate until fully incorporated.

                      Bake the cheesecake:

                        - Pour the cheesecake filling into the cooled crust, smoothing the top with a spatula.

                          - Bake in the preheated oven for 55-65 minutes, or until the edges are set but the center is still slightly wobbly.

                            - Turn off the oven, crack the door open, and let the cheesecake cool in the oven for 1 hour to prevent cracking.

                              Cool and chill:

                                - Remove the cheesecake from the oven and let it cool to room temperature. Once cooled, c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, preferably overnight.

                                  Prepare the ganache:

                                    - In a small saucepan, heat the heavy cream until just simmering. Remove from heat and add the chopped semi-sweet chocolate. Let it sit for a few minutes before stirring until smooth.

                                      - Stir in the Godiva chocolate liqueur if using. Allow the ganache to cool slightly before pouring it over the chilled cheesecake.

                                        Garnish and serve:

                                          - Once the ganache has set, remove the sides of the springform pan.

                                            - Garnish the top of the cheesecake with chocolate shavings or curls and dollops of whipped cream as desired.

                                              - Slice and enjoy your indulgent Godiva chocolate cheesecake!

                                                Prep Time: 20 minutes | Total Time: 8 hours (including chilling time) | Servings: 12 slices
